Steimsnibba
Steimsnibba is a peak in Stranda, Møre og Romsdal, Western Norway and has an elevation of 1,114 metres. Steimsnibba is situated nearby to the hamlet Sunnylvsbygda, as well as near Storstein.Places of Interest

Sunnylven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Stranda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. It is located in the village of Hellesylt, at the end of the Sunnylvsfjorden.

Hellesylt is a small village in Stranda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. The village lies at the head of the Sunnylvsfjorden, which is a branch of the Storfjorden, and which the more famous Geirangerfjorden in turn branches off nearby.
